List of railway stations in Taiwan : ウィキペディア英語版 | List of railway stations in Taiwan Recently there are four railway operating companies in Taiwan: : Some of the THSR are union stations with the TRA in the same name, some are in different names, and some even in different places with the TRA. So the THSR stations are called "''THSR XX Station''" to separate from the stations of TRA. The Taipei Metro and the Kaohsiung MRT are the urban metro in Taipei and Kaohsiung metropolitan area. The Taipei Metro opened on March 1996, the Kaohsiung MRT on March 2008. == Taiwan Railway Administration == Most Taiwan Railway Administration station names have been romanized using Hanyu Pinyin since 2008, although some major stations named after counties and major cities retain their traditional spelling, e.g., Keelung and Kaohsiung. The names were romanized using Wade–Giles before 2002 and Tongyong Pinyin from 2002 to 2008.
